Lionel Messi continues to gather his friends at Inter Miami. According to Olt Sports, following Luis Suárez, David Beckham's club is considering signing the Argentine defender from Boca Juniors, Marcos Rojo.
It is noted that Messi called Rojo and invited him to join him in the United States.
In addition to Inter Miami, the Brazilian club Palmeiras is also interested in signing Rojo.
Rojo is the captain of Boca Juniors, but due to injuries, he has only played in 16 matches this season. His contract with the Argentine club expires in December 2025.
Throughout his career, Rojo has played for Manchester United, Sporting Lisbon, Estudiantes, and Spartak Moscow. For the Argentine national team, he has appeared in 61 matches and scored 3 goals.
